Goldshell LT Lite, targeting Scrypt mining, delivers 1.62Gh/s at 1450W. This model is celebrated for its efficiency, appealing to Litecoin and Dogecoin miners with its competitive performance and a manageable noise level of 55db.

The Goldshell LT Lite incorporates advanced ASIC technology optimized for the Scrypt algorithm, featuring a proprietary cooling system that ensures consistent 24/7 operation without thermal throttling. Its firmware supports seamless over-the-air updates, ensuring users can easily apply the latest optimizations for performance and security. Additionally, the LT Lite has built-in fail-safes to prevent hardware damage in case of power surges or connectivity issues. It also features a user-friendly web interface for monitoring and adjusting settings remotely, and its efficient power supply unit (PSU) is designed to maximize energy conversion efficiency, reducing heat generation and overall energy consumption.



Algorithm Information: Scrypt

Scrypt is a password-based key derivation function that was originally designed to be computationally intensive and memory-hard, making it more resistant to brute-force attacks compared to other algorithms such as SHA-256. The algorithm was first used as the proof-of-work in the cryptocurrency Litecoin and later in several other altcoins. It is also used in some password storage systems to prevent hackers from using massive amounts of computing power to guess passwords by cracking hashes.
